What NBA Teams Did Vince Carter Play For?

The Journey of Vince Carter: From Rookie to NBA Legend

Vince Carter, widely regarded as one of the greatest dunkers in NBA history, had an illustrious career spanning over two decades. Throughout his time in the league, Carter played for several teams, each contributing to his legacy as a basketball icon.

1. Toronto Raptors (1998-2004)

After being drafted by the Golden State Warriors as the fifth overall pick in the 1998 NBA Draft, Carter was immediately traded to the Toronto Raptors. It was in Toronto where he first made a name for himself, earning the nickname ‘Air Canada’ and captivating fans with his electrifying dunks and scoring prowess.

2. New Jersey Nets (2004-2009)

In 2004, Carter was traded to the New Jersey Nets, where he formed a dynamic duo with Jason Kidd. Together, they led the Nets to multiple playoff appearances and showcased Carter’s versatility as a scorer and playmaker.

3. Orlando Magic (2009-2010)

During the 2009-2010 season, Carter had a brief stint with the Orlando Magic. Although his time in Orlando was relatively short, he made a significant impact and helped the team make a deep playoff run.

4. Phoenix Suns (2010-2011)

Following his time in Orlando, Carter joined the Phoenix Suns. Despite being in the latter stages of his career, he continued to showcase his scoring ability and veteran leadership on the court.


5. Dallas Mavericks (2011-2014)

Carter then signed with the Dallas Mavericks, where he played a vital role in their championship-winning season in 2011. His experience and clutch performances were instrumental in the team’s success.

6. Memphis Grizzlies (2014-2017)

From 2014 to 2017, Carter joined the Memphis Grizzlies, bringing his veteran presence to a young and talented team. Despite his age, he remained a reliable contributor and mentor to the team’s rising stars.

7. Sacramento Kings (2017-2020)

In his final years in the NBA, Carter played for the Sacramento Kings. Although his playing time decreased, he continued to be a respected figure in the league and a beloved teammate.

8. Atlanta Hawks (2020)

Carter’s last stop in the NBA was with the Atlanta Hawks. At the age of 43, he became the first player in NBA history to have a career spanning four decades, leaving a lasting impact on the game.


Vince Carter’s journey through the NBA took him to multiple teams, where he left an indelible mark on each franchise. His high-flying dunks, scoring ability, and longevity in the league solidified his status as a basketball legend. Carter’s impact and influence on the game will be remembered for generations to come.

Rate this post